Essential Functions

  • Leadership and Management-Provide strong leadership, guidance, and support to Business Development Managers and their team within their region
  • Strategic Planning-Develop and execute strategic plans for the region to achieve financial targets, market expansion and business growth
  • Performance monitoring-Monitor branch performance indicators such as deposit growth, small business loan origination, customer satisfaction and compliance with bank policy and procedures
  • Customer Relationship Management-Foster a customer-centric culture, emphasizing exceptional customer service, and manage escalated customer issues
  • Compliance and Risk Management-Ensure that all branches within the region adhere to banking regulations, policies and procedures, and manage risk effectively
  • Business Development-Identify opportunities for market growth, customer acquisition, and cross-selling bank products and services
  • Market Analysis-Stay informed about local economic conditions, competitor activities, and market trends to adapt strategies accordingly
  • Reporting-Provide regular reports and updates to the Head of Retail on regional performance, challenges and opportunities
  • Staffing and succession planning-Oversee staffing levels, manage personnel issues and plan for succession within the region. In rare occurrences, cover branches as necessary to attain branch goals.
